Comprehensive Guide to PHI Authorization Form

What is the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ure?

The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ure is a vital document in healthcare that allows for the release of protected health information (PHI). Understanding this form is crucial as it plays an essential role in the authorization process, ensuring that patient data can be shared legally and securely.
PHI refers to information that can identify an individual regarding their health condition, healthcare services, or payment for healthcare. This information is critical for healthcare providers to ensure continuity of care and is governed by privacy laws to protect patient confidentiality.

Purpose and Benefits of the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ure

Patients need to authorize their health information release to ensure that their data is shared appropriately with healthcare providers or entities. This authorization is founded on both legal requirements and patient rights, maintaining the integrity of the healthcare system.
  • Ensures compliance with laws governing PHI.
  • Protects patient privacy by requiring explicit consent.
  • Facilitates smoother communication between healthcare entities.

Key Features of the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ure

The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ure consists of various sections designed to collect necessary information. Key components include:
  • Individual information section to identify the patient.
  • Purpose of the information release.
  • Description of the specific information to be disclosed.
  • Signature requirements from individuals and their personal representatives.

Who Needs the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ure?

This form is essential for individuals who wish to access their PHI or have authorized representatives acting on their behalf. Personal representatives may include guardians or individuals with power of attorney.
Anyone involved in obtaining access to health information, be it for treatment or other purposes, should be aware of this authorization form's role in safeguarding patient information.

How to Fill Out the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ure Online

Filling out the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ure requires careful attention to detail. Follow these steps to ensure accurate completion:
  • Enter individual identification information in the prescribed fields.
  • Provide the purpose for which the information is being released.
  • Specify the type of PHI to be disclosed.
  • Sign and date the form, ensuring all required signatures are included.
Be cautious of common mistakes such as leaving fields blank or providing unclear information, as these can delay the processing of your authorization.

Submission Methods for the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ure

Once the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ure is complete, it can be submitted through various methods. These include:
  • Mailing the form to the designated healthcare provider.
  • Faxing the completed form to the appropriate office.
  • Submitting the form in person for immediate processing.
For secure submission, ensure that the form is protected during transmission, especially if sent by mail or fax.

What Happens After You Submit the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ure?

After submission, your completed Standard Authorization Form for PHI Disclosure undergoes a review process by the healthcare provider. The processing time can vary, and patients should expect:
  • Notification of approval or denial of the request.
  • Possibility of a request for additional information if needed.
Staying informed about the status of your submission ensures you are prepared for any follow-up actions that may be necessary.

Any individual needing to authorize the release of their protected health information (PHI), or a personal representative acting on their behalf, is eligible to use this form in Pennsylvania.
Deadlines may vary based on the purpose of disclosure. It’s important to check with healthcare providers or insurers regarding any time-sensitive requirements related to the form's submission.
After completing the form, it can be submitted electronically via pdfFiller, downloaded for manual submission, or printed and sent to the designated healthcare entity or insurance provider.
Usually, no additional documents are required with the Standard Authorization Form unless specified. However, be ready to provide identification if needed for verification.
Ensure all sections are accurately completed without leaving blank fields. Common mistakes include incorrect personal details or failing to sign the form. Always review before submission.
Processing times can vary depending on the healthcare organization or insurance provider. Generally, it may take several days to a week, so plan accordingly.
You have the right to revoke the authorization at any time. To do this, it’s best to contact the healthcare provider or insurance company directly and follow their procedures for revoking access.
